Output e58539d8a7fd95639c540ec49435329a1697f1bad150213a05a9003d74cc659d:0
- value
- 8500366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9922b8745ab3eafcf63e719b4b05ae6862d25d2b OP_EQUAL
- address
- 3FeiuKQhi56fC1uv8LzNcoXpBLZJejqzFU
- transaction
- e58539d8a7fd95639c540ec49435329a1697f1bad150213a05a9003d74cc659d